Presentation, medical complications and development of gestational trophoblastic neoplasia of hydatidiform mole after intracytoplasmic sperm injection as compared to hydatidiform mole after spontaneous conception - a retrospective cohort study and literature review

CONCLUSIONS: Singleton HM after ICSI are diagnosed earlier in gestation, present with fewer medical complications, and may be less likely to develop GTN when compared with HM after SC.PMID:36706644 | DOI:10.1016/j.ygyno.2023.01.016
